1. Prepping Your Skin: The Foundation of Successful Makeup
To ensure long-lasting makeup and a professional finish, the first step is to properly prepare your skin. This process is akin to preparing a canvas for painting: clean and hydrated skin allows makeup products to adhere better and appear more natural. Here are the essential steps:
- Deep Cleanse: First and foremost, wash your face with a cleanser suited to your skin type to remove impurities and excess oil. Clean skin allows products to penetrate better and helps avoid pore clogging.
- Gentle Exfoliation: Exfoliate lightly once or twice a week. This removes dead skin cells and prepares your skin for a smoother foundation application and other makeup products.
- Facial Toner: Applying a toner after cleansing helps balance the skin’s pH and tighten pores, setting the stage for the following products.
- Moisturizing: Moisturizer is a crucial step to keep skin supple. Even oily skin needs hydration and should be treated with specific products. Hydrated skin prevents makeup from caking throughout the day.
- Sunscreen: A good sunscreen should be the final step in your prep routine, protecting your skin from UV damage that can compromise the skin barrier.
2. Essential Products for an Even Base
For anyone aiming for makeup with a smooth finish, choosing the right products can make all the difference. Pre-makeup products like primers and setting sprays help create an even skin tone and ensure makeup durability.
- Primer: A high-quality primer smooths skin texture and minimizes the appearance of pores and fine lines. There are primers tailored to various skin types, such as mattifying primers for oily skin and illuminating ones for dry skin.
- BB or CC Cream: If you prefer a lighter, more natural finish, a BB or CC cream can be an excellent alternative to foundation. These products not only even out skin tone but often offer additional benefits like sun protection and hydration.
3. Post-Makeup Care: The Importance of Cleansing and Skin Recovery
Removing makeup properly is essential for skin health. Sleeping with makeup on clogs pores, preventing the skin from breathing and regenerating overnight. Here’s what should be part of your nightly ritual:
- Makeup Remover: Use a bi-phase or oil-based makeup remover to remove more resistant products, like waterproof mascara and long-lasting lipstick. Oil dissolves makeup without excessive rubbing.
- Double Cleansing: After using makeup remover, wash your face with a gentle cleanser to ensure a thorough cleanse, removing any remaining makeup remover or product residue.
- Night Serum: An antioxidant serum helps the skin recover from daily damage. Ingredients like vitamin C and hyaluronic acid aid in skin regeneration and deep hydration.
- Night Moisturizer: Finish with a richer moisturizer or one specifically formulated for nighttime use. This will keep your skin nourished as you sleep.

4. How to Personalize Your Skincare Routine
Not all skin types respond to products in the same way. Knowing your skin type and its specific needs is crucial to tailoring a routine that works for you:
- Oily Skin: Opt for gel-based, oil-free products to avoid excess shine.
- Dry Skin: Choose creamy, hydrating products rich in nourishing ingredients like ceramides and plant oils.
- Combination Skin: Use products designed for different areas of the face. Apply oil-control products in the T-zone and hydrating ones on the cheeks.
- Sensitive Skin: Look for gentle, fragrance-free formulas to avoid irritation.
5. Tricks to Extend the Longevity of Your Makeup
Maintaining intact makeup throughout the day involves a few simple tricks. Using setting sprays, blotting papers, and light touch-ups are essential to keep a shine-free, flawless look:
- Setting Spray: A setting spray locks in makeup and helps extend wear, especially on warmer days.
- Translucent Powder: To prevent makeup from melting, apply translucent powder to the oily areas of your face.
- Light Touch-Ups: Carry blotting papers with you to absorb excess oil throughout the day without disturbing your makeup.
